Any droning while driving around? Are you happy with the sound?

evil_1998 01-30-2013 10:16 PM

Zero drone. In car cabin noise is minimal, slightly louder than stock when cruising, got a nice rumble.

On WOT can hear exhaust throughout rev range. Fine for daily driving, won't deafen your ear drums.

Previously with just Q300 catback, intake sound was louder than exhaust. Exhaust was only slightly louder during WOT, sounded almost stock.

Soundwise definitely prefer it with the Overpipe & Testpipe installed.
